Transaction 91e70b6e19fc603c875cf6c3cc4de3e44bf9dcf063ea8fc1aa57e57dbb1898a9

30 Input
2 Outputs
  • 91e70b6e19fc603c875cf6c3cc4de3e44bf9dcf063ea8fc1aa57e57dbb1898a9:0
  • value  868957366
    address  3NAVdoVNKtatze3T5zPLsn2g283kfwxXNN
  • 91e70b6e19fc603c875cf6c3cc4de3e44bf9dcf063ea8fc1aa57e57dbb1898a9:1
  • value  7000000000
    address  34r4AvuLSsBhxDJ2D2rVJUYbG6Ttb1DMBw